Home
last modified time | relevance | path

Searched refs:desc_index (Results 1 – 17 of 17) sorted by relevance

/openbmc/linux/drivers/firmware/arm_scmi/
H A Dsensors.c69 __le32 desc_index; member
262 unsigned int desc_index, in iter_intervals_prepare_message() argument
271 msg->index = cpu_to_le32(desc_index); in iter_intervals_prepare_message()
331 s->intervals.desc[st->desc_index + st->loop_idx] = in iter_intervals_process_response()
367 const unsigned int desc_index, in iter_axes_desc_prepare_message() argument
375 msg->axis_desc_index = cpu_to_le32(desc_index); in iter_axes_desc_prepare_message()
408 a = &apriv->s->axis[st->desc_index + st->loop_idx]; in iter_axes_desc_process_response()
549 unsigned int desc_index, in iter_sens_descr_prepare_message() argument
554 msg->desc_index = cpu_to_le32(desc_index); in iter_sens_descr_prepare_message()
582 s = &si->sensors[st->desc_index + st->loop_idx]; in iter_sens_descr_process_response()
H A Dprotocols.h195 unsigned int desc_index; member
216 void (*prepare_message)(void *message, unsigned int desc_index,
H A Dvoltage.c127 unsigned int desc_index, in iter_volt_levels_prepare_message() argument
134 msg->level_index = cpu_to_le32(desc_index); in iter_volt_levels_prepare_message()
171 p->v->levels_uv[st->desc_index + st->loop_idx] = val; in iter_volt_levels_process_response()
H A Dclock.c203 const unsigned int desc_index, in iter_clk_describe_prepare_message() argument
211 msg->rate_index = cpu_to_le32(desc_index); in iter_clk_describe_prepare_message()
263 switch (st->desc_index + st->loop_idx) { in iter_clk_describe_process_response()
278 u64 *rate = &p->clk->list.rates[st->desc_index + st->loop_idx]; in iter_clk_describe_process_response()
H A Dperf.c317 unsigned int desc_index, in iter_perf_levels_prepare_message() argument
325 msg->level_index = cpu_to_le32(desc_index); in iter_perf_levels_prepare_message()
391 opp = &p->perf_dom->opp[st->desc_index + st->loop_idx]; in iter_perf_levels_process_response()
H A Ddriver.c1546 iops->prepare_message(i->msg, st->desc_index, i->priv); in scmi_iterator_run()
1556 if (st->num_returned > st->max_resources - st->desc_index) { in scmi_iterator_run()
1571 st->desc_index += st->num_returned; in scmi_iterator_run()
/openbmc/linux/drivers/net/ethernet/hisilicon/hns3/hns3pf/
H A Dhclge_regs.c302 u32 entries_per_desc, desc_index, index, offset, i; in hclge_get_dfx_reg_bd_num() local
317 desc_index = offset / entries_per_desc; in hclge_get_dfx_reg_bd_num()
318 bd_num_list[i] = le32_to_cpu(desc[desc_index].data[index]); in hclge_get_dfx_reg_bd_num()
373 int entries_per_desc, reg_num, desc_index, index, i; in hclge_dfx_reg_fetch_data() local
381 desc_index = i / entries_per_desc; in hclge_dfx_reg_fetch_data()
382 *reg++ = le32_to_cpu(desc[desc_index].data[index]); in hclge_dfx_reg_fetch_data()
H A Dhclge_debugfs.c1776 struct hclge_desc *desc_index = desc_src; in hclge_dbg_imp_info_data_print() local
1789 le32_to_cpu(desc_index->data[j++])); in hclge_dbg_imp_info_data_print()
1791 le32_to_cpu(desc_index->data[j++])); in hclge_dbg_imp_info_data_print()
1794 desc_index++; in hclge_dbg_imp_info_data_print()
H A Dhclge_main.c2686 u32 desc_index = 0; in hclge_parse_fec_stats_lanes() local
2692 desc_index++; in hclge_parse_fec_stats_lanes()
2696 if (desc_index >= desc_len) in hclge_parse_fec_stats_lanes()
2700 le32_to_cpu(desc[desc_index].data[data_index]); in hclge_parse_fec_stats_lanes()
/openbmc/u-boot/drivers/mtd/nand/raw/
H A Dmxs_nand.h68 uint32_t desc_index; member
H A Dmxs_nand.c84 if (info->desc_index >= MXS_NAND_DMA_DESCRIPTOR_COUNT) { in mxs_nand_get_dma_desc()
89 desc = info->desc[info->desc_index]; in mxs_nand_get_dma_desc()
90 info->desc_index++; in mxs_nand_get_dma_desc()
100 for (i = 0; i < info->desc_index; i++) { in mxs_nand_return_dma_descs()
106 info->desc_index = 0; in mxs_nand_return_dma_descs()
/openbmc/linux/drivers/net/ethernet/samsung/sxgbe/
H A Dsxgbe_main.c465 int desc_index; in init_rx_ring() local
507 for (desc_index = 0; desc_index < rx_rsize; desc_index++) { in init_rx_ring()
509 p = rx_ring->dma_rx + desc_index; in init_rx_ring()
510 ret = sxgbe_init_rx_buffers(dev, p, desc_index, in init_rx_ring()
518 rx_ring->dirty_rx = (unsigned int)(desc_index - rx_rsize); in init_rx_ring()
524 while (--desc_index >= 0) { in init_rx_ring()
527 p = rx_ring->dma_rx + desc_index; in init_rx_ring()
528 sxgbe_free_rx_buffers(dev, p, desc_index, bfsize, rx_ring); in init_rx_ring()
/openbmc/linux/drivers/ufs/core/
H A Dufshcd-priv.h52 int desc_index,
88 int ufshcd_read_string_desc(struct ufs_hba *hba, u8 desc_index,
H A Dufs-sysfs.c633 u8 desc_index, in ufs_sysfs_read_desc_param() argument
651 ret = ufshcd_read_desc_param(hba, desc_id, desc_index, in ufs_sysfs_read_desc_param()
H A Dufshcd.c3494 int desc_index, in ufshcd_read_desc_param() argument
3520 desc_id, desc_index, 0, in ufshcd_read_desc_param()
3524 __func__, desc_id, desc_index, param_offset, ret); in ufshcd_read_desc_param()
3593 int ufshcd_read_string_desc(struct ufs_hba *hba, u8 desc_index, in ufshcd_read_string_desc() argument
3607 ret = ufshcd_read_desc_param(hba, QUERY_DESC_IDN_STRING, desc_index, 0, in ufshcd_read_string_desc()
/openbmc/linux/drivers/net/ethernet/microchip/
H A Dlan743x_main.c2008 int desc_index; in lan743x_tx_frame_add_fragment() local
2011 desc_index = tx->frame_first; in lan743x_tx_frame_add_fragment()
2012 while (desc_index != tx->frame_tail) { in lan743x_tx_frame_add_fragment()
2013 lan743x_tx_release_desc(tx, desc_index, true); in lan743x_tx_frame_add_fragment()
2014 desc_index = lan743x_tx_next_index(tx, desc_index); in lan743x_tx_frame_add_fragment()
/openbmc/linux/include/ufs/
H A Dufshcd.h1365 int ufshcd_read_string_desc(struct ufs_hba *hba, u8 desc_index,